Idaho , USA

Idaho is a state in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States. Known for its stunning natural landscapes, including mountains, rivers, and forests, Idaho offers a unique blend of outdoor adventures and charming small towns. It's a paradise for nature lovers and those seeking a peaceful retreat.

Quick Facts

Nickname

The Gem State

Population

1,900,000

Climate

Continental - Idaho has a continental climate with four distinct seasons. Winters are cold and snowy, especially in the mountainous regions, while summers are warm and dry. Spring and autumn are mild and pleasant.

Best Time to Visit

Peak Season

June to August

This is the best time to visit Idaho for outdoor activities like hiking, camping, and fishing. The weather is warm, and the landscapes are lush and green.

Shoulder Season

April to May and September to October

Shoulder seasons offer mild weather and fewer crowds. It's a great time for hiking, biking, and exploring the state's cultural attractions.
